diff options
author | Torsten Veller <tove@gentoo.org> | 2010-10-14 10:29:13 +0000 |
---|---|---|
committer | Torsten Veller <tove@gentoo.org> | 2010-10-14 10:29:13 +0000 |
commit | 5304a56d5826a6ed11d211547696eeecb241124c (patch) | |
tree | c3654ff56142ef1e33364278605e0e7e18d63e38 /perl-core/Test-Harness | |
parent | Bump from stable to update mono dep. (diff) | |
download | historical-5304a56d5826a6ed11d211547696eeecb241124c.tar.gz historical-5304a56d5826a6ed11d211547696eeecb241124c.tar.bz2 historical-5304a56d5826a6ed11d211547696eeecb241124c.zip |
Fix test failure with perl-5.12
Package-Manager: portage-2.2_rc95/cvs/Linux x86_64
Diffstat (limited to 'perl-core/Test-Harness')
-rw-r--r-- | perl-core/Test-Harness/ChangeLog | 6 | ||||
-rw-r--r-- | perl-core/Test-Harness/Manifest | 15 | ||||
-rw-r--r-- | perl-core/Test-Harness/Test-Harness-3.17.ebuild | 3 | ||||
-rw-r--r-- | perl-core/Test-Harness/files/3.17-taint.patch | 19 |
4 files changed, 29 insertions, 14 deletions
diff --git a/perl-core/Test-Harness/ChangeLog b/perl-core/Test-Harness/ChangeLog index c0e2d320e566..b457a7e54ab8 100644 --- a/perl-core/Test-Harness/ChangeLog +++ b/perl-core/Test-Harness/ChangeLog @@ -1,6 +1,10 @@ # ChangeLog for perl-core/Test-Harness # Copyright 1999-2010 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/perl-core/Test-Harness/ChangeLog,v 1.57 2010/09/13 09:01:48 tove Exp $ +# $Header: /var/cvsroot/gentoo-x86/perl-core/Test-Harness/ChangeLog,v 1.58 2010/10/14 10:29:12 tove Exp $ + + 14 Oct 2010; Torsten Veller <tove@gentoo.org> +files/3.17-taint.patch, + Test-Harness-3.17.ebuild: + Fix test failure with perl-5.12 13 Sep 2010; Torsten Veller <tove@gentoo.org> -Test-Harness-3.20.ebuild, -Test-Harness-3.21.ebuild: diff --git a/perl-core/Test-Harness/Manifest b/perl-core/Test-Harness/Manifest index 364b28b62b8f..82a5e37156cd 100644 --- a/perl-core/Test-Harness/Manifest +++ b/perl-core/Test-Harness/Manifest @@ -1,16 +1,7 @@ ------BEGIN PGP SIGNED MESSAGE----- -Hash: SHA1 - +AUX 3.17-taint.patch 550 RMD160 131d09015158309acbd815a77d233a0e894b0fbb SHA1 4e4a3da3b76409e40350a720cfe41105b1274a11 SHA256 1f99568fc1ec9ed98fbb052bcb6585635ba16dab5f7090582044bb494290c637 DIST Test-Harness-3.17.tar.gz 210311 RMD160 d654f2be5beb17dcea50f2d99963a7350d29d368 SHA1 cc4572113f553fbc55a5a5a1e791dcde4433cc45 SHA256 193a15e251ebb81e0e76d637c4baeee00f1d6445ff1f9b087c0859657a076948 DIST Test-Harness-3.22.tar.gz 292705 RMD160 42bde1ba6ff8868910aa430c055519e45d4cf1d8 SHA1 7b97cc6bb96f31dd709eb7f77ed908f1b414191a SHA256 40f00451f017396c45da691faea1c050a56abfc7a0129425e010286b1f62c1c5 -EBUILD Test-Harness-3.17.ebuild 731 RMD160 0af9c7878bd32abdd8c2a13e23a7ee8953015905 SHA1 ddaa17770b97738be7c9cf797a355e48c4d3efde SHA256 b7a9fb92198cca64656b5265998027e344827e031dc5151b94c901ab53bc6675 +EBUILD Test-Harness-3.17.ebuild 773 RMD160 63e84ca4204e669377d3a43cb861b06990331fd7 SHA1 b16e558bcdc5411c138d6c8aec47fb238a29ba76 SHA256 3bf0de14086a7183c7515632adf89f0822d8997295dc32783ba50988e03ecd31 EBUILD Test-Harness-3.22.ebuild 725 RMD160 f7f2c7fcda5e2036f172eb9add90e9a5450ce9df SHA1 8433377507d22006f21e8dbcc2d79e5f950acd46 SHA256 5669ec9f336c0a5ada2cb4c6c78428ecbe619acb53b5e1743ac2dda3ac7cb07d -MISC ChangeLog 11386 RMD160 0a8231af6601e9c1fa85b9ed3baaa15af12e1009 SHA1 71e42b0ea803568fc02d1b3d35ecbfb70ce3571f SHA256 b13f1245cb49da72ed1a1cf080d5eb389a443227657a2e5a090f9eecc44a3c1a +MISC ChangeLog 11522 RMD160 b9862853f2586622738872cdb15efc5a8bc1bd11 SHA1 5ffd41fe164b3fe15242373facfd5a08af504d0f SHA256 7a496fa970d9c5e908073dc865d945a30d759c713b5cb7f38fa16170cbd7c9ef MISC metadata.xml 238 RMD160 985404a5a7176277ef4c4b00040ee16ac5153954 SHA1 d4ac5ebf658293e14783abe7f07aaad707f4bae0 SHA256 ed65f2488c5b1c5dfdb686b157fa1357d77b8e4d1d8d6bdb0281fea40cb8dbb1 ------BEGIN PGP SIGNATURE----- -Version: GnuPG v2.0.16 (GNU/Linux) - -iEYEARECAAYFAkyTfpwACgkQV3J2n04EauxB2QCeLOP7FwuAHZOZexvNPOaHgHyc -SOMAoIBlCE41oRCvDObKdZDYsTIYtGpC -=Hvn/ ------END PGP SIGNATURE----- diff --git a/perl-core/Test-Harness/Test-Harness-3.17.ebuild b/perl-core/Test-Harness/Test-Harness-3.17.ebuild index f0c89f6a4441..c1fbc4a33a34 100644 --- a/perl-core/Test-Harness/Test-Harness-3.17.ebuild +++ b/perl-core/Test-Harness/Test-Harness-3.17.ebuild @@ -1,6 +1,6 @@ # Copyright 1999-2010 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/perl-core/Test-Harness/Test-Harness-3.17.ebuild,v 1.9 2010/01/05 19:10:18 nixnut Exp $ +# $Header: /var/cvsroot/gentoo-x86/perl-core/Test-Harness/Test-Harness-3.17.ebuild,v 1.10 2010/10/14 10:29:12 tove Exp $ MODULE_AUTHOR=ANDYA inherit perl-module @@ -16,3 +16,4 @@ DEPEND="dev-lang/perl" PREFER_BUILDPL=no SRC_TEST="do" mydoc="rfc*.txt" +PATCHES=( "${FILESDIR}"/3.17-taint.patch ) diff --git a/perl-core/Test-Harness/files/3.17-taint.patch b/perl-core/Test-Harness/files/3.17-taint.patch new file mode 100644 index 000000000000..ede8150dd57e --- /dev/null +++ b/perl-core/Test-Harness/files/3.17-taint.patch @@ -0,0 +1,19 @@ +--- Test-Harness/t/sample-tests/taint ++++ Test-Harness/t/sample-tests/taint +@@ -3,5 +3,5 @@ + use lib qw(t/lib); + use Test::More tests => 1; + +-eval { kill 0, $^X }; ++eval { `$^X -e1` }; + like( $@, '/^Insecure dependency/', '-T honored' ); +--- Test-Harness/t/sample-tests/taint_warn ++++ Test-Harness/t/sample-tests/taint_warn +@@ -6,6 +6,6 @@ use Test::More tests => 1; + my $warnings = ''; + { + local $SIG{__WARN__} = sub { $warnings .= join '', @_ }; +- kill 0, $^X; ++ `$^X -e1`; + } + like( $warnings, '/^Insecure dependency/', '-t honored' ); |